From the Class drop-down menu, select New. Enter the class name. If it's a subclass, select the Subclass of checkbox and find the class it's under in. Select OK to add it. WebJun 24, 2024 · The below sample gets the filter on the active sheet, then uses the getRange () method from this class to log the range that the filter applies to. let ss = SpreadsheetApp.getActiveSheet(); // Gets the existing filter on the active sheet. let filter = ss.getFilter(); // Logs the range that the filter applies to in A1 notation.
